Transaction 5e6dbeaaa58def6ee6ecb187988c180ab066dc841dff1d43ef24ddf689054893
1 Input
1 Output
-
5e6dbeaaa58def6ee6ecb187988c180ab066dc841dff1d43ef24ddf689054893:0
- value
- 41008
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8afedb86829a949c63e23b616fa65f8873e9846 OP_EQUAL
- address
- 3MSkdiG7jwprSocLRFNMjBuXnbErmDb4ST